Rama Jutglar, known professionally as Ramilla de Aventura, is a Spanish YouTube star and internet personality famous for his travel vlogs and daily lifestyle videos. He launched his YouTube channel in 2019 and posted his first video on February 9, 2020. Since then, he has gained significant popularity, amassing over 103 million views on YouTube. Ramilla's content often highlights the cultural importance of the places he visits, and one of his most popular videos, titled "This City Is Unreachable For 4 Months A Year🥶❌️ (Yakutsk)" has garnered over four million views. Currently residing in Madrid, Spain, Ramilla is celebrated for his engaging travel series and the unique experiences he shares with his audience.

Richard Meek (born 15 June 1982) is a British musical theatre actor. Born in King's Lynn, Norfolk, Richard gained an interest in drama from an early age through taking part in much amateur dramatics at his local theatre. At the age of 16 he left home to study drama at the College of West Anglia. Five years later, he left college with GCSE, A Level and HND in Dance, Drama and Singing. He then moved to London to join the London School of Musical Theatre, where he graduated with distinction a year later. After graduating he went on to play the Mikado in Upstairs at the Gatehouse's Christmas 2004 production of The Hot Mikado on the London Fringe. The show received rave reviews, and was Time Out Critics' Choice. During early 2005, Richard spent some time doing modelling work before returning to theatre in September, when he got the part of lead vocalist in the UK tour of Give My Regards to Broadway. After finishing with the tour in November, he went straight into rehearsals for Sleeping Beauty at the Lichfield Garrick - an original pantomime, full of original songs and starring a West End musical cast - where he played Prince Claude. He also sang live on BBC Radio West Midlands at the Birmingham Symphony Hall that Christmas. Richard was involved with the tour of Joseph and the Amazing Technicolor Dreamcoat for almost all of 2006. Two weeks after finishing in panto, he got the part of Judah, where he was also featured as the One More Angel in Heaven soloist, the gospel soloist in Go Go Go Joseph, and the Apache dancer in Those Canaan Days. After six months, the director asked him to audition for the part of alternate Joseph. He got the role, and after only one performance was asked to play the lead for three weeks while the principal (Ian "H" Watkins) was away. Of course, he jumped at the chance, and got great reviews from the three tour stops where he played the lead - Skegness, Dundee and Wimbledon. He spent several months playing the role of Joseph three times a week and Judah for the other nine shows, and took over as principal Joseph on 22 November 2006. He played his last show as Joseph on 16 December 2006. Richard joined the UK tour of The Rocky Horror Show on 27 January 2007 in Nottingham, playing the role of Brad Majors. He was with the tour for 6 months until it closed. He played his last show as Brad on 14 July in Woking. He also understudied Frank N. Furter, but never went on in the role. In 2015 he joined the cast of The Rocky Horror Show Live which was celebrating the 40th anniversary of the film version's release. He played the dual roles of Eddie and Eddie's uncle, Dr. Everett Von Scott. The show ran for two weeks from 11 to 26 September. He rejoined the cast of The Rocky Horror Show in 2016, first playing the role of Eddie / Dr Scott replacing Paul Cattermole until switching to play Brad Majors once more later in the tour until the close of the tour on 31 December 2016 in Oxford. From an early age, Morganna discovered two things: her artistic vocation and her gender identity. When she was only four years old, she started singing and was a soloist in the school's nuns' choir. According to her own words, one day she woke up and felt her feminine identity living inside her body. She began to put on makeup and emulate female TV stars. This of course, caused a shock in her family and she faced rejection. She first defined herself as a gay boy, despite knowing that deep down she was a woman. She began her musical training at the School of Music of the University of Guanajuato. In 2001 she decided to emigrate to Mexico City to continue her musical training at the National Conservatory of Music. Eventually, she began to collaborate with an opera company. There she decided to define her identity and began her transition process, which lasted four years without any family support. After a process of hormonal and psychological therapy, in 2012 she decided to undergo sex reassignment surgery in Thailand. There, thanks to her participation in a trans beauty contest entitled Miss International Queen, she learned of the existence of the prestigious surgeon Preecha Triewtanon, one of the great world eminences of sex reassignment surgeries. It was he who gifted her the surgery. Her operation was performed by surgeon Burin Wangjiraniran of the PAI (Preecha Aesthetic Institute) clinic and brought Morganna closer to the ideal life she was seeking. Interestingly, her transition as a woman was a crucial part of her professional recognition. Morganna's transition was captured by filmmaker Flavio Florencio in a documentary entitled Made in Bangkok. The documentary was released worldwide in 2017 and achieved several recognitions, including an Ariel Award nomination from the Mexican Film Academy for Best Documentary Feature. The success of the documentary brought Morganna the spotlight. She intervened as an actress in the series Crónica de castas (2014) and in the short film Oasis (2017), by Alejandro Zuno. Her most important challenge, was the release of her first album titled Dos vidas en una (2017), where she shows her prodigious voice in a combination of genres ranging, from opera arias, to pop ballads. In 2018, Morganna participated in the reality show The Voice, in its Mexican edition, making it all the way to the semifinals on Anitta's team. In 2017, Morganna also published her autobiographical book entitled In the Right Body. At the same time, Morganna continues to perform in different venues around the world. In 2018, Morganna lent her voice to the character of Blanca Evangelista in the Latin American dub of the Fox Premium series Pose. In 2020, Morganna participates in the film 10 Songs for Charity, a Dutch production directed by Karin Junger. Her activism for the respect and visibility of trans women in society, made that, in 2020, Love was recognized by Forbes as one of the 100 most powerful women in Mexico. Morganna also serves as an activist for the United Nations. In 2021, Morganna participates in the HBO series Maid.
